TEST RUN button

This  button  is  used  when  installing  the
conditioner,  and  should  not  be  used  un-
der normal conditions, as it will cause the
air conditioner’s thermostat function to op-
erate incorrectly.

If this button is pressed during normal op-
eration, the unit will switch to test opera-
tion mode, and the Indoor Unit’s OPERA-
TION Indicator Lamp and TIMER Indicator
Lamp will begin to flash simultaneously.

To stop the test operation mode, press the
START/STOP button to stop the air condi-
tioner.
